                  The Rays locked up Evan Longoria through the 2016 season.
                  The contract breaks down as follows.

                  Longoria's salary starts at $500,000 this season and maxes out at $11.5-million in his ninth season if the Rays pick up the option. The breakdown:
                  2008 - $500,000
                  2009 - $550,000
                  2010 - $950,000
                  2011 - $2-million
                  2012 - $4.5-million
                  2013 - $6-million
                  2014 - $7.5-million or $3-million buyout
                  2015 - $11-million or $1-million buyout of two-year option.
                  2016 - $11.5-million
                  Longoria will also donate up to $725,000 during the contract to the Rays Baseball Foundation.
